What is Kaleido Biosciences LT-Debt-to-Total-Asset?

Kaleido Biosciences KLDO -99.00% LT-Debt-to-Total-Asset is 0.11 as of Dec. 2021.

LT Debt to Total Assets is a measurement representing the percentage of a corporation's assets that are financed with loans and financial obligations lasting more than one year. The ratio provides a general measure of the financial position of a company, including its ability to meet financial requirements for outstanding loans. It is calculated as a company's Long-Term Debt & Capital Lease Obligationdivide by its Total Assets. Kaleido Biosciences's long-term debt to total assests ratio for the quarter that ended in Dec. 2021 was 0.11.

Kaleido Biosciences's long-term debt to total assets ratio declined from Dec. 2020 (0.31) to Dec. 2021 (0.11). It may suggest that Kaleido Biosciences is progressively becoming less dependent on debt to grow their business.

Kaleido Biosciences LT-Debt-to-Total-Asset Calculation

Kaleido Biosciences's Long-Term Debt to Total Asset Ratio for the fiscal year that ended in Dec. 2021 is calculated as

LT Debt to Total Assets (A: Dec. 2021 )=Long-Term Debt & Capital Lease Obligation (A: Dec. 2021 )/Total Assets (A: Dec. 2021 )
=5.55/50.137
=0.11

Kaleido Biosciences Business Description

Address 65 Hayden Avenue, Lexington, MA, USA, 02421
Kaleido Biosciences Inc is a clinical-stage healthcare company. It is focused on leveraging the potential of the microbiome organ to treat disease and improve human health. Its product candidates are Microbiome Metabolic Therapies, or MMTs, which are designed to modulate the metabolic output and profile of the microbiome.
